In this overview we see the layout of components:
from the left (forward), we in turn:
-
Servo rudder - rudder shaft passing from the plane (there is little in this photo)
- engine propeller
- electronic control box (which contains the servo control unit and its batteries)
- their speed and servo control knob (above the box)
- 10Ah-12V battery to power the motor
- container pasture
in two successive pictures and details of the servo axis helm, this could be achieved with a simple termination T as the servant, in our case is bent as a result of tests to optimize the rotation and travel of the rudder
you see in the next the detail of the rudder blade. It consists of an axis integral with the structure of the boat (one of the top section) and a lighter which is fixed the loader, which is hinged on the first rotation to allow
we see in the next the details of the joint propeller shaft with the engine axis
we see in the subsequent implementation of the next boat that involves the application of 2 hinges for the closure of the stabilizing fins seen excessive saving during transport.
To keep them open during use is subject to a steel wire spacer, as is evident from the photos
